STORYLINE:

Along with Malawi government officials, the 10th batch of the Chinese medical team gathered at the Chinese embassy in Lilongwe Friday to mark the 60th anniversary of sending the first China Medical Team abroad as well as the 15th anniversary of the Chinese Medical Team to Malawi.

The medical and health field is one of the key areas of cooperation between the two countries.

So far, China has dispatched 10 batches of medical teams to Malawi, with a total of 170 people, treating more than 200,000 patients.

In 2008, the Chinese government deployed a team of 19 specialist doctors to Malawi soon after the two countries established diplomatic relations.

The various batches of Chinese Medical Teams comprising physicians, surgeons, anesthesiologists, pediatricians, gynecologists, obstetricians and radiologists are deployed to Mzuzu Central Hospital in north Malawi and Kamuzu Central Hospital in the capital city, Lilongwe.

The Chinese government in April 1963 dispatched the first medical team to Algeria.

Since then, China has dispatched a total of 30,000 doctors to 76 countries and regions in Africa, Asia, America, Europe and Oceania, diagnosing and treating 290 million patients.
